Key Responsibilities
Bookkeeping & Financial Support
- Process invoices and maintain accurate financial records
- Manage accounts payable and accounts receivable
- Record and categorize daily financial transactions
- Prepare and enter journal entries
- Perform account and bank reconciliations
- Assist with the preparation of financial statements and internal reports
- Maintain organized accounting records and supporting documentation
- Use accounting software, particularly QuickBooks, to record and manage transactions
- Assist management with additional bookkeeping and financial administrative needs
- Help ensure financial records are complete, accurate, and maintained in a timely manner
Administrative Support
- Support day-to-day office and administrative operations
- Maintain organized physical and electronic files
- Prepare, organize, and update company records and documents
- Manage correspondence and assist with professional communications
- Schedule meetings and assist with calendar coordination
- Prepare reports, spreadsheets, and other administrative materials
- Assist management and team members with special projects
- Help track deadlines, follow-ups, and outstanding administrative items
- Provide general support to leadership and other departments as needed
